Technology and Applications of metal bed frame support parts
Metal bed frame support parts play a crucial role in ensuring the durability, stability, and comfort of bed frames. The key components include:
1. Center Support Bars: These bars run from the head to the foot of the bed, providing extra support to the middle section, which is crucial for preventing sagging. They often come with adjustable legs to cater to various bed heights and add additional support to the slats or foundation.
2. Side Rails: These are the horizontal beams that connect the headboard and footboard. Typically made from sturdy metals like steel or aluminum, they provide the primary structural support for the bed.
3. Support Slats: Metal slats distribute weight evenly across the mattress, offering a firm foundation. They can be spaced closely together or used in conjunction with wooden slats for added strength.
4. Corner Brackets: These brackets join the side rails to the headboard and footboard, ensuring a stable and rigid frame. They are often designed for easy assembly and disassembly.

Quality Testing Methods for metal bed frame support parts and how to control quality
Quality testing methods for metal bed frame support parts involve several key steps to ensure durability, safety, and compliance with standards. Here are the primary methods and controls:
Testing Methods
1. Material Inspection:
– Chemical Analysis: Use spectrometry to verify the chemical composition of the metal.
– Mechanical Properties Testing: Conduct tensile strength, hardness, and impact tests to assess the material’s durability and resilience.
2. Dimensional Inspection:
– Gauge and Measurement Tools: Use calipers, micrometers, and coordinate measuring machines (CMM) to ensure parts meet specified dimensions.
– Template Matching: Compare parts against templates or jigs to verify shape and size consistency.
3. Weld Quality Inspection:
– Visual Inspection: Check for visible defects such as cracks, porosity, and undercuts.
– Non-destructive Testing (NDT): Utilize ultrasonic, magnetic particle, or dye penetrant testing to detect internal defects without damaging the parts.
4. Load Testing:
– Static Load Test: Apply a gradually increasing load until the part reaches its maximum load capacity to ensure it can handle the expected weight.
– Fatigue Test: Repeatedly apply stress to simulate long-term usage and identify potential points of failure.
5. Corrosion Resistance Testing:
– Salt Spray Test: Expose parts to a saline mist environment to assess corrosion resistance over time.
– Coating Thickness Measurement: Ensure protective coatings meet required thickness for optimal protection.

FAQs on Sourcing and Manufacturing from metal bed frame support parts in China
FAQs on Sourcing and Manufacturing Metal Bed Frame Support Parts in China
1. Why source metal bed frame parts from China?
China offers competitive pricing, a wide variety of manufacturers, and high production capacity. This makes it a cost-effective option for sourcing metal bed frame support parts.
2. How do I find reliable manufacturers?
Use online platforms like Alibaba, Made-in-China, and Global Sources. Look for manufacturers with verified profiles, positive reviews, and relevant certifications. Attending trade shows and hiring sourcing agents can also help.
3. What certifications should I look for?
Ensure manufacturers have ISO 9001 for quality management. Other certifications like BSCI or Sedex indicate good social compliance practices.
4. What are the common manufacturing processes for metal bed frame parts?
Key processes include cutting, bending, welding, stamping, and powder coating. The choice of process depends on the design and material specifications.
5. How do I ensure quality control?
Implement a rigorous quality assurance process. This includes pre-production samples, in-line production inspections, and final random inspections. Hiring third-party inspection services like SGS or TÜV can provide additional assurance.
6. What are typical lead times?
Lead times vary but generally range from 30 to 60 days. This includes time for production, quality checks, and shipping preparation.
7. How do I handle shipping and logistics?
Work with experienced freight forwarders who can manage sea or air shipping. Consider FOB (Free on Board) terms, where the supplier handles goods until they are on the ship, simplifying logistics for you.
8. What are the payment terms?
Common terms include a 30% deposit before production and 70% balance before shipment. Letter of Credit (L/C) and Trade Assurance on Alibaba are other secure payment methods.
9. How do I protect my intellectual property (IP)?
Use Non-Disclosure Agreements (NDAs) and Non-Compete Agreements (NCAs). Register your IP in China and work with legal experts to draft enforceable contracts.
10. What should I know about tariffs and duties?
Stay updated on current trade policies. Working with customs brokers can help navigate tariffs, duties, and ensure compliance with import regulations.
